Egyptian journalist shot in clashes dies

State-run newspaper Al-Ahram said tonight an Egyptian reporter shot during clashes earlier this week died today of his wounds, the first reported journalist death in 11 days of turmoil surrounding Egypt’s wave of anti-government protests.

Al-Ahram said Ahmed Mohammed Mahmoud, 36, was taking pictures of clashes on the streets from the balcony of his home, not far from central Tahrir Square, when he was “shot by a sniper” four days ago. It said in a report on its website that he died today in hospital.
